Low melting point metal or alloy powders atomization manufacturing processes

Atomization processes for manufacturing a metal powder or an alloy powder having a melting point comprising of about 50 Celsius to about 500 Celsius are provided herein. In at least one embodiment, the processes comprise providing a melt of a metal or an alloy having said melting point of about 50 Celsius to about 500 Celsius through a feed tube; diverting the melt at a diverting angle with respect to a central axis of the feed tube to obtain a diverted melt; directing the diverted melt to an atomization area; and providing at least one atomization gas stream to the atomization area. The atomization process can be carried out in the presence of water within an atomization chamber used for the atomization process. In at least one embodiment, the processes provide a distribution of powder with an average particle diameter under 20 microns with geometric standard deviation of lower than about 2.0.

METHOD FOR OBTAINING ENCAPSULATED NANOPARTICLES

A method for obtaining at least one particle, including: (a) preparing solution A including at least one precursor of at least one of Si, B, P, Ge, As, Al, Fe, Ti, Zr, Ni, Zn, Ca, Na, Ba, K, Mg, Pb, Ag, V, Te, Mn, Ir, Sc, Nb, Sn, Ce, Be, Ta, S, Se, N, F, and Cl; (b) preparing aqueous solution B; (c) forming droplets of solution A; (d) forming droplets of solution B; (e) mixing droplets; (f) dispersing mixed droplets in a gas flow; (g) heating dispersed droplets to obtain the at least one particle; (h) cooling the at least one particle; and (i) separating and collecting the at least one particle. The aqueous solution is acidic, neutral, or basic. In step (a) and/or step (b) at least one colloidal suspension of a plurality of nanoparticles is mixed with the solution. Also, a device for implementing the method.

Apparatus for a mass production of monodisperse biodegradable polymer-based microspheres and a multi-channel forming device incorporatable therein

A method and an apparatus for a large-scale production of monodisperse microspheres and biodegradable polymer-based drug delivery systems and design optimization method for the apparatus are provided. The method uses a plurality of microchips, each microchip having at least a first pathway, a second pathway and an outlet, wherein the first pathway and the second pathway merge at a cross point being one end of the outlet, and the method comprises preparing a polymer-phase solution including a degradable polymer and a water-phase solution including a surfactant, having the polymer-phase solution flow through the first pathway, having the water-phase solution flow through the second pathway, gathering a mixed solution flowing out of the outlet, and collecting the microspheres by filtering out the water-phase solution.

DEVICE FOR SPHERIFICATION OF A LIQUID

A device for spherification of a liquid includes a first device for storing a first liquid; and a spherification tank for storing a second liquid, arranged so that the second liquid defines a level of the second liquid in the spherification tank. A device meters the first liquid coming from the first tank into the spherification tank. An extraction device extracts spheres generated in the spherification tank as a result of the metering. The extraction device includes a worm screw located in the spherification tank, the worm screw being arranged at an angle to the level, and a motor for rotating the worm screw.

APPARATUS AND METHOD FOR CRYOGRANULATING A PHARMACEUTICAL COMPOSITION

Cryogranulation systems with improved dispenser assemblies are provided for use in manufacturing frozen pellets of pharmaceutical substances in a fluid medium. Methods of cryogranulating the pharmaceutical substance in the fluid medium are also provided. In particular embodiments, the dispenser assembly is used with suspensions or slurries of pharmaceutical compositions including biodegradable substances, such as proteins, peptides, and nucleic acids. In certain embodiments, the pharmaceutical substance can be adsorbed to any pharmaceutically acceptable carrier particles suitable for making pharmaceutical powders. In one embodiment, the pharmaceutical carrier can be, for example, diketopiperazine-based microparticles. The dispenser assembly improves the physical characteristics of the cryopellets formed and minimizes product loss during processing.

SYSTEM AND METHOD FOR GRANULATING AND MOLDING SILICON LIQUID

The present disclosure provides a system and method for granulating and molding silicon liquid. The system includes a silicon liquid transferring device, wherein cooling system and a lifting system matching with the cooling system are provided below the silicon liquid transferring device. The silicon liquid transferring device transfers smelted silicon liquid to a position above the cooling system, uniformly pours the silicon liquid into the cooling system according a set flow to enable the silicon liquid to be solidified into silicon pellets, and then the molded silicon pellets are extracted by the lifting system, solving the problem in the prior art of irregular molding and inconsistent size of silicon blocks caused by pouring. A container bottom and a diversion pipe are set to be of detachable structures, and can be quickly disassembled and assembled as vulnerable parts without affecting the production.
